Quibi is a mobile-only streaming service, launching tomorrow. Short for “quick bites,” the content on Quibi will be made to be enjoyed throughout the day, between other activities. Here’s what to know about this service before launch day.

Launch Date

Quibi launches tomorrow, April 6, 2020.

Content

At launch, Quibi will include only original content. That content will include:

  • Movies, shown in short chapters, including Most Dangerous Game, starring Liam Hemsworth
  • Unscripted series like Chrissy’s Court with Chrissy Teigen
  • Daily essentials, including news, sports, and weather

Plans and Pricing

Quibi will cost $4.99 with ads and $7.99 without ads.

How to Watch

Quibi is a mobile-only service and will be available on iOS and Android devices.

What Sets it Apart?

Thanks to a keynote event at CES this year, we learned about a few of the features that will make Quibi different than other streaming services currently available.

  • It’s mobile only, with content formatted specifically for mobile devices.
  • A turn style feature will allow users to switch from landscape to portrait while watching, without missing any details of the viewing experience.
  • Some Quibi content will include immersive features that will customize the experience based on everything from time of day to personal viewing preferences.
  • All content will be original, from daily shows to game show reboots to movies.
